Instant Pot Transylvanian Goulash
Instant Pot Transylvanian goulash is similar to Hungarian goulash with the addition of sauerkraut. You might think that the briny, fermented flavor of sauerkraut would clash, but it enhances the flavor even more.
Carne Guisada for the Instant Pot – Beef Stew
Carne Guisada for the Instant Pot brings a hardy dish that is perfect in cold weather as a stew. It is great for the summer for tacos or to use as a meaty sauce for enchiladas. What usually takes two to three hours in a Dutch oven takes about 35 minutes in the Instant Pot.
